The Tuscarora High Key club is collecting pennies for patients during FLEX between now and April 12th. All the money collected goes to the Leukemia and Lymphoma society. Students will be visiting various FLEX classes collecting whatever change or even bills that people are willing to donate.
This round of soliciting donations began the 25th of March and will end the 12th of April. Pennies for Patients is a three-week program Elementary and Middle Schools where students collect change and raise funds online while learning about service and philanthropy. It appears that the fundraiser is a yearlong project.
Since 1994, this fundraiser for a social cause has demonstrated to kids that even small efforts can make an impact on the world. The main idea being that even small donations add up to big things. In just one week, out Key club has raised over $150.00 for the cause and is hoping to raise even more next week. While it may not seem like much, the dollars add up and every little bit helps to provide goods and services to people who are battling serious and often deadly diseases.
